The renewal of our three-year agreement with Torvane Materials has been assessed in detail. Proposed terms include a 4.2% unit-price increase, partially offset by improved volume rebates and extended payment terms of sixty days. Sensitivity analysis indicates a net annual cost impact of under 1% on the Meridia product line, assuming stable demand. Legal has flagged no material changes to liability clauses. We recommend approval, subject to the conditions outlined in the confidential note below.

confidential, yawip-bahif: Zorokox Partners plans to lower the Casax list price by 28.0 percent in April. The board signed off on a budget of $271.0 million for Project Juldor. The renewal with Pelokox Partners closes at $410.1 million a year, 3.4 percent below the last contract. Project Pelok slips by a full year because of the audit delay.

Welcome to the Ladleworks team. Your first task touches the recipe-scaling calculator, which converts yields across batch sizes for the Pantrybook app. Please read the unit-conversion notes before editing the fraction rounding logic, as small errors compound at large scales. To access the staging environment for the first time, enter the recovery passphrase shown below.

recovery phrase for bawep-kawef: oliath-casdor

## Basement Archive Room (B-04)

The Hallmere House archive room holds paper records for Project Quillstone and older Verdant Logic contracts. New starters: access is badge-plus-code. Take the east stairwell past the plant room; the archive door is the grey one marked B-04. Lights are on a timer — press the override if they cut out. Sign the ledger on entry and exit. No food, no boxes left on the floor. The current door code is below.

staff pass of kawip-hawef = bdg-QLP-2